Types of SS Pipe – 304, 316, Seamless & Welded Explained
Stainless steel (SS) pipes are among the most widely used piping materials across industries, thanks to their corrosion resistance, strength, and hygienic properties. Whether it’s for plumbing, food processing, or chemical applications, SS pipes offer unmatched reliability. But with different grades and types available, choosing the right one is crucial.
Why Choose Stainless Steel Pipes?
Unlike MS or GI pipes, SS pipes resist rust, scale, and chemical corrosion, making them ideal for plumbing and high-pressure industrial systems. They also maintain hygiene, making them suitable for drinking water and food industries.
- High corrosion resistance (even in harsh conditions)
- Durability and long service life
- Can withstand high pressure and temperature
- Hygienic for food, water, and pharma industries
Main Types of SS Pipe
1. SS 304 Pipes
The most common grade, SS 304 pipes, are known for their corrosion resistance and affordability. They are widely used in domestic water supply, kitchen plumbing, and mild chemical industries.
2. SS 316 Pipes
SS 316 pipes contain molybdenum, which makes them more resistant to chloride and saline environments. They are ideal for marine, chemical plants, and food processing units.
3. Seamless SS Pipes
Seamless stainless steel pipes are manufactured without joints, giving them superior strength. They are used in high-pressure systems, boilers, and petrochemical plants.
4. Welded SS Pipes
Welded SS pipes are produced by welding sheets or coils. They are more cost-effective than seamless pipes and suitable for low to medium pressure applications.
Comparison – Seamless vs Welded SS Pipes
Feature | Seamless SS Pipe | Welded SS Pipe |
---|---|---|
Strength | High (no weld joints) | Moderate (welded seam present) |
Pressure Handling | Excellent | Good for medium use |
Cost | Expensive | Affordable |
Applications | Boilers, oil & gas, petrochemicals | Plumbing, construction |
Applications of Stainless Steel Pipes
- Plumbing Systems: Long-lasting and hygienic for water supply
- Food & Beverage Industry: Safe for processing and transport
- Chemical Plants: Resistant to corrosive chemicals
- Construction: Structural use due to high strength

FAQs – Types of SS Pipe
1. Which is better: SS 304 or SS 316?
SS 316 is better for marine and chemical environments, while SS 304 works well for general plumbing.
2. Are seamless SS pipes stronger than welded?
Yes, seamless pipes are stronger and used in high-pressure systems.
